Cambria Foreign Shareholder Yield ETF (BATS:FYLD – Get Free Report) was the recipient of a significant drop in short interest in August. As of August 14th, there was short interest totaling 36,872 shares, a drop of 43.3% from the July 30th total of 64,976 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 133,996 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.3 days. Approximately 0.3% of the company’s shares are sold short.

Cambria Foreign Shareholder Yield ETF Company Profile
The Cambria Foreign Shareholder Yield ETF (FYLD)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in total market equity. The fund is actively managed to invest in Developed Ex-US stocks with focus on shareholder yield, as measured by dividend payments and net share buybacks. FYLD was launched on Dec 3, 2013 and is managed by Cambria.
